
Cooking from the Heart by John Besh
Cooking from the Heart, Chef John Besh's third cookbook, revisits the locations, lessons, and mentors that shaped his culinary journey. From Germany's Black Forest to the mountains of Provence, each chapter highlights heartfelt memories and delicious recipes-the framework for his love of food. The all-new, easy-to-follow recipes, complete with regional substitution suggestions, make creating upscale farm-to-table dishes accessible for any at-home chef. The rich production values and personal narrative make this cookbook an equally engaging read.

James Beard Award-winner John Besh is a renowned chef, owner of nine restaurants, host of John Besh’s Family Table on public television, and author of the best-selling cookbooks My New Orleans and My Family Table. He lives with his wife and four boys outside New Orleans, Louisiana.
